Youth Ink - A Creative Writing Contest for Orinda's 6th, 7th and 8th Graders

Youth Ink 2012, the annual creative writing contest open to all sixth-, seventh- and eighth-grade students who live or attend school in Orinda.  

The Youth Ink 2012 theme is,  “There is a Knock at the Door.” 

The first rule is to write about anything you like: Real or imaginary. There is no limit to your imagination.  Whatever you write about, just remember to have fun!

Youth Ink 2012 submissions are accepted on an ongoing basis but must be hand-delivered to a designated school representative or postmarked by Feb. 10, 2012 and mailed to Orinda Junior Women’s Club, Post Office Box 40, Orinda, CA 94563 in order to be considered for an award. 

Youth Ink 2012 entry forms are available online at www.orindajuniors.org or through the OIS English department, Orinda Library, Orinda Academy, Athenian School, Julia Morgan School for Girls, John Ogro, DDS Orthodontics’ office, SmartLounge, Orinda Books, Kumon Lafayette, and Storyteller bookstore.

Generous co-sponsors of Youth Ink 2012, including The Orinda Association and The Orinda Community Foundation, have made it possible to provide impressive prizes:

  • $250 for 1st place,  $125 for 2nd place,  $75 for 3rd place
  • 10 honorable mentions who receive gift certificates from a local book store
